    Adsorptive Catalytic Voltammetric Determination of Chrysophanol at Carbon Paste Electrode

    • In an ammoniacal buffer solution of pH 9.5,and by accumulation at 0 V(vs.SCE) for 60 s scanning linearly from 0 to -1.0 V at the rate of 250 mV·s-1,a sensitive adsorptive catalytic voltammetric peak given by chrysophanol was observed at the carbon paste electrode at the potential of -0.61 V (vs.SCE).Linear relationship between values of 2nd derivative of peak current and concentration of chrysophanol was obtained in the range of 2.0×10-10-1.0×10-8mol·L-1,with its detection limit (3S/N) of 1.0×10-10mol·L-1.A preliminary discussion on the voltammetric behavior and electrochemical mechanism of electrode reaction of chrysophanol at both the carbon paste electrode and mercury electrode was also given.This method was used in the determination of chrysophanol in sample of seminacassiae,and using this sample as matrix,recovery was tested by standard additon method,giving results of recovery in the range of 96.8% to 104.8%.
